摘要
The electrical characteristics, charge collection efficiency and energy resolution of a GaAs detector made out of LEC material have been studied. A matrix of 36 square pixels was deposited on a 70 mu m thick crystal; each pixel had an area of 200 X 200 mu m(2) with 20 mu m spacing between adjacent pixels. This detector showed a charge collection efficiency uniformity among the pixels better than 88% when exposed to 60 keV photons, which ensures that a comfortable common threshold setting can be adopted without affecting the uniformity of the measurement. It was successful in recording (60 keV photon energy) the image of a wolframium slab, 100 mu m thick.
